Common signs of grief & loss
- Intense sadness or sorrow
- Feelings of anger or frustration
- Difficulty concentrating
- Changes in sleep patterns
- Withdrawal from social activities
Coping strategies that may help
Journaling
Write down your thoughts and feelings to help process your emotions and reflect on your experiences.
Mindfulness Practices
Engage in mindfulness exercises, such as deep breathing or meditation, to help ground yourself in the present moment.
Connect with Others
Reach out to friends or support groups to share your feelings and experiences, reminding you that you are not alone.
Create a Memory Ritual
Establish a personal ritual to honor your loved one, such as lighting a candle or creating a memory box.
When to seek professional help
If your grief feels overwhelming or unmanageable, consider seeking professional support. The Samaritans offer a free, 24/7 helpline at 116 123 for those in need.
